I just found this deal at SoundRite Acoustics on Roxul AFB and thought others might be interested:
Sixteen (16!) panels of 3" x 24" x 48" Roxul AFB for $84.33. Shipping to my location (Long Beach, CA) is just $9.91. http://tinyurl.com/2fryf6k
For comparison, ATS sells a 6 pack of 2" x 24" x 48" AFB for $34 and shipping to my location is another $34.
http://tinyurl.com/27a262p
Of course, the shipping may be different to your location, so you may not get such a great deal. But for me, this SoundRite deal may make those superchunks do-able after all.

Well, it turns out this deal isn't real. I placed my order online a few days ago. I got an email today saying they don't have a distributor in my area and are canceling my order.
They distribute AFB in NY, MA, CT, NH, FL, NJ, DC, PA, MD.

I would not use Ultratouch. Besides it's expensive.
Johns Manville Insul-Shield is your best bet.
Viking Insulation in Burbank carries it.
There should be a distributer down in the LBC area.
